qileilove

          blog已經轉移至github,大家請訪問 http://qaseven.github.io/

          《笑傲測試》筆記(第七式:語報平安)

           主題:如何書寫測試報告

            領導們通常是很關注測試的,因為通常只有測試團隊才能夠提供項目所處的真正位置。這種位置感來源于模塊的成熟度、穩定度和主要問題列表。這種信息,我們叫它項目的可視性信息。可視性信息可以分為兩類:

            1)對內的信息匯總,以測試日志為典型,記錄每個測試工程師一天的進度、發現和困難,上報給測試經理;

            2)對外的信息發布,以測試報告為典型。測試經理匯總測試的數據和信息,作為項目進度和狀態的重要標識上報給項目管理者。

            一、測試日志(Test Log)

            測試日志是幫助測試經理獲取測試信息的重要途徑,它的發布者是測試團隊中的每一個成員,測試日志的讀者是測試經理,而在規模大一些的測試團隊中,可能是測試小組的組長。測試日志的使命是讓測試經理了解自己團隊的狀況。

            二、測試報告(Test Report)——言簡意賅、圖文并茂

            測試報告寫作的七大原則:

            (1)字數要夠少夠精煉

            用最少的篇幅和最簡單的結構同時傳達出所有的關鍵信息,這才是測試報告應該做的事。

            1、首先要減少說廢話套話,和測試無關的語言越少越好;

            2、其次要避免過于細節,在報告后面可以盡情地添加附件來提供詳細的信息,給求知欲強的人留有進一步專研的空間;

            3、最后,信息要分層派送,比如封面上三句話說出你最想說的心里話,中間的內容把這三點展開來說,最后的封底處作出你作為測試人員對待測軟件的評價和結論。

            (2)圖表要夠多夠通俗

            1、餅圖比大小(軟件遺留問題模塊分布)

            2、柱圖比高矮(各測試組發現問題個數)

            3、曲線圖上躥下跳(軟件穩定度的變化,問題解決率的變化,測試用例通過率的變化)

            4、面積圖比胖瘦(遺留問題的解決趨勢)

            5、圖表要用的正確才有效

            項目管理者關注的大部分東西都有合適的圖表來表示:

            1、總體成熟度和子模塊的成熟度:成熟度的計算方式有很多,其中最簡單的是統計測試用例的通過率,我們在上面講曲線圖的時候有例子。

            2、缺陷分布:各種模塊內遺留的問題數目及其比例,能幫助讀者大略了解各個模塊的穩定程度,餅圖就是個很好的例子。

            3、缺陷趨勢:成熟度的變化趨勢,從中可以看出軟件質量的走向,也是那個曲線圖的例子。

            4、問題解決趨勢,這是個很有用的關注點,從中可以看出問題解決的速度和趨勢。當問題解決的速度下降的時候,能夠及時向管理層報警提起重視,面積圖的例子講的就是這方面的東西。

           圖表能夠標出各測試組或測試工程師的效率和進度,以便及時發現暗藏的問題,避免進度受影響;圖表還能顯示出各模塊問題數和測試用例通過率的關系。

            (3)顏色鮮艷,通俗易懂

            綠色代表一切正常,紅色代表糟糕,黃色代表不好說。在測試報告中用綠色表示穩定的模塊,紅色表示有問題的模塊。

            (4)既報喜又報憂,匯總出最嚴重的問題

            在測試報告中列出未解決的TOP10嚴重故障。評審的對象之一就是剩余的嚴重問題都有哪些,以及產品帶著這些問題上市的風險有多大,測試人員公正和客觀的評價將是一個重要的參考。

            (5)報告時間要及時

            測試報告是為了讓項目的管理者在第一時間了解項目的狀態,因此報告的時間不能拖拖拉拉,新聞變成了舊聞就不值錢了。根據報告的重要程度和所做測試量的大小,測試報告準備的時間也應當不一樣。

            (6)羅列的數據準確有力

            測試關注質量,但如果測試本身的質量無法保證,那測試還不如不做。測試內部需要建立抽查機制:

            1、抽查應該成為一種持續的壓力,不能搞獻禮工程;

            2、抽查的比例要事先約定,根據是抽查的工作量和可投入的人力等;

            3、執行抽查的人必須有經驗或者夠權威,否則抽查出問題以后必將導致無休止的爭論。

            4、參考以往的趨勢(比如:測試用例通過率變化明顯部分抽查)

            (7)邏輯要經得起推敲

            測試報告中要做出很多結論,要注意結論的邏輯必須經得起推敲,做出的結論要有說服力。

          版權聲明:本文出自 hellorenwei 的51Testing軟件測試博客:http://www.51testing.com/?578951

          原創作品,轉載時請務必以超鏈接形式標明本文原始出處、作者信息和本聲明,否則將追究法律責任。

          相關鏈接:

          《笑傲測試》筆記(前言+第一式:廬山面目)

          《笑傲測試》筆記(第二式:蓬門始開)

          《笑傲測試》筆記(第四式:矯如龍翔)

          《笑傲測試》筆記(第五式:浮云遮日)

          《笑傲測試》筆記(第六式:伯仲伊呂)

          posted on 2012-11-30 11:55 順其自然EVO 閱讀(236) 評論(0)  編輯  收藏 所屬分類: 測試學習專欄

          <2012年11月>
          28293031123
          45678910
          11121314151617
          18192021222324
          2526272829301
          2345678

          導航

          統計

          常用鏈接

          留言簿(55)

          隨筆分類

          隨筆檔案

          文章分類

          文章檔案

          搜索

          最新評論

          閱讀排行榜

          評論排行榜

          主站蜘蛛池模板: 旌德县| 巴彦县| 应用必备| 揭西县| 台东县| 都匀市| 泽州县| 岳阳县| 巫溪县| 彝良县| 高台县| 顺义区| 油尖旺区| 长治市| 乌审旗| 吴江市| 阿拉善盟| 迁安市| 五原县| 民勤县| 治县。| 凉城县| 江川县| 博白县| 栾川县| 本溪市| 合水县| 临清市| 榆社县| 越西县| 宁波市| 射洪县| 大厂| 招远市| 毕节市| 安西县| 阳城县| 鄂托克旗| 缙云县| 浦东新区| 含山县|